Crystal Palace form and stats
2 victories, 4 draws and 1 defeat. That’s what Crystal Palace have to build on here at Selhurst Park in the Premier League. Palace has three losses from their three previous games and the tension is increasing in the dressing room for both the manager P. Vieira and the players.
Palace haven't scored a league goal since they found the net 180 minutes ago. M. Guehi scored that one.
Palace lost their last game at Manchester United (placed 6th) after a 0-1 scoreline. Midfielder Conor Gallagher was the best player on the team with a rating of 7.62 (out of ten) in that game. Gallagher hit two key passes, dribled past the opponent 1 of 1 times and had 36 successful passes (of 40 total).
Heartbreak before that as Palace lost 0-1 at Leeds United's place.This is expected to be a close game, with Crystal Palace perhaps considered small favourites due to their home advantage. Looking back at earlier matches similar to this one (expected to be close with Crystal Palace as a small favourite), we find eight games. Palace has won four of these, drawn two and lost two.
Another home game is coming up fairly shortly for the hosts, as Southampton are coming to town in three days.
Palace has scored 10 league goals at home this season, in 7 matches. Crystal Palace have only conceded 6 from their league home games. For more goal stats, check the Statistics tab above.
Everton form and stats
The hunting on away grounds haven’t been very fruitful for Everton so far with only 5 points returning home. The records show 1-2-4 (win-draw-lose). Three consecutive losses in away matches means Everton are growing more and more desperate for a good performance on the road.
Everton had fun at their own home (Selhurst Park) last time out, beating Arsenal 2-1. Richarlison and Demarai Gray scored. Late drama in the previous game, when Demarai Gray scored the winning goal two minutes into stoppage time to defeat Arsenal. Attacker Richarlison got a player rating of 8.32 in the game. "Man of the match" Richarlison scored one goal, hit four key passes and dribled past the opponent 3 of 4 times.
Preceding that, the 1-4 home loss versus Liverpool.So, this is expected to be a close game, an even contest. Looking at earlier matches with Everton playing away and similar expectations, we found four relevant matches. Results were three Everton wins, zero draws and one defeat.
The visitors will be packing their bags again in only four days as another away game awaits: The Premier League trip to Chelsea.
The attacking power of Everton when travelling is not overwhelming with 6 goals scored from 7 league matches away. In the opposite end, Everton have conceded 12 goals in their away games.
Head 2 Head
Last ten meetings between these sides: Palace won zero, Everton were winners in five and we saw five draws. four games with over 2,5 goals, six matches with two goals or less.Top Goalscorers
